Goals

Peace Lutheran Preschool desires to assist you in the development of your child.  You, as parents, are the best teacher of your children and we wish to encourage and support your relationship with your child as much as possible. Often the preschool experience is the first time that a child has serious learning time away from their parents. Realizing the various challenges to this new learning environment, Peace Lutheran Wee Creations Preschool desires to offer a well-rounded program that will:

  • Provide a Christian atmosphere in which your child can play and learn

  • Seek to develop a moral outlook on life from a Christian perspective

  • Permit your child to become aware of the loving presence of God in their life

  • Develop your child’s ability to listen attentively and follow directions

  • Increase their ability to handle their emotions in a positive, constructive manner

  • Teach your child the limits of behavior with regard to safety, and to respect the rights of others

  • Help your child achieve more independence

  • Establish the foundation for future learning in their elementary education.
